2012-02-26 14 views
2

私はUITableViewController内のセクション全体(in内の行を含む)の順序を変更できる方法を探しています。私の検索は、これが「箱から出して」可能イマイチことを示唆している UITableViewControllerの行の並び替え

Reordering UITableView sections on the iPhone by dragging (like reordering rows)

はので、私はそれを行う方法を確立しようとしています...これにつながっています。

私が持っていたアイデアの1つは、各セルに新しいUITableViewを持つ「マスター」UITableViewが存在するように、UITableViewsをネストすることでした。これらの「スレーブ」UITableViewは、効果的に各セクションのセルを持つだけです。

理論では、Master TableViewでは、通常のようにセルを並べ替えることができますが、それはまるでセル全体のセットを含むことになります。

重要な点...これを実装するには、変更可能なセクション数が必要であり、各セクションには可変数の行があります。

これが可能かどうかについて誰かが意見を持っていますか?

思考/アドバイスはiOSの5以降

答えて

4

を高く評価し、あなたはmoveSection:toSection: APIを経由して、全体のセクションを移動することができます。

UITableView Class Reference

+0

ありがとう! –

関連する問題